WebNov 14, 2024 · Chitin is a polysaccharide made of linked N -acetylglucosamine subunits. It has the chemical formula (C 8 H 13 O 5 N) n. The structure of chitin is most similar to that of cellulose. Its function is … WebChitin is a major carbohydrate component of the fungal cell wall and a promising target for novel antifungal agents. WebAug 2, 2024 · 2. Chitin chemistry and crystal structure. Chitin is a polysaccharide composed of 1–4 linked 2-acetamido-2-deoxy-β-d-glucopyranose, figure 2.
